Benedikt Ursprung is a researcher at the forefront of nanoscale sensing and force measurement, with a focus on developing innovative tools to probe mechanical signals in physical and biological systems. His most-cited work, "Infrared nanosensors of pico- to micro-newton forces" (2024), introduces a novel approach for remotely detecting mechanical forces with exceptional sensitivity and spatial resolution—capabilities critical for advancing fields such as robotics, biophysics, energy storage, and medicine. This paper, already garnering early citations, highlights his ability to bridge fundamental physics with practical applications, offering a new paradigm for measuring forces at the nanoscale. Ursprung’s contributions are particularly impactful for researchers studying mechanobiology, where understanding piconewton-level forces can reveal insights into cellular processes, and for engineers designing responsive nanomaterials. His work stands out for its interdisciplinary reach, addressing challenges from energy storage diagnostics to medical sensing. With a growing citation record and a focus on high-impact, precision-driven research, Ursprung is establishing himself as a key innovator in nanophotonics and force sensing, promising to enable new discoveries in both basic science and applied technology.
